Elements Influencing Sash Window Repair Costs
The expense of repairing sash windows in the UK is not a one-size-fits-all situation. Various elements add to the last costs, including:
Type of Repair Required:
Different issues require various levels of repair. Some common types of repairs consist of:
Re-glazing: Repairing or replacing broken glass panes.Restringing: Fixing or changing the cords that make it possible for the sashes to move efficiently.Repairing Rot: Addressing damage triggered by wood rot or insect problems.Painting and Finishing: Refreshing the paint to protect the wood and enhance appearance.
Product and Quality of the Wood:
The quality of the wood used for repairs will substantially impact the total cost. Top quality wood will cost more but offer remarkable resilience.
Area and Location:
Geographic place plays a vital role in figuring out repair expenses. Urban areas typically have greater labor rates compared to rural places due to require and availability.
Professional Expertise:
Hiring a specialist can typically cause increased costs due to their proficiency in historical windows. However, it might save you cash in the long run due to their quality work.
Level of Damage:
The more severe the damage, the greater the repair expenses. Small problems can typically be fixed with very little cost, while extensive damage may require a total overhaul.
Approximated Costs for Sash Window Repairs
The following table supplies an overview of common Sash Window Repair And Refurbishment window repair services and their estimated costs in the UK:
Repair TypeAverage Cost (₤)DescriptionRe-glazing100 - 250Replacing damaged or broken glass panesRestringing50 - 100Replacing cords or chains for sashesWood Rot Repair150 - 300Treatment of rotten wood, might include partial replacementPainting80 - 150Stripping and repainting to safeguard woodComplete Restoration500 - 1,500+Comprehensive repairs to bring back performance and looks
Keep in mind: Prices might differ based upon the specific place and seriousness of the damage.
Common Issues with Sash Windows
Sash windows, while charming, are susceptible to a variety of typical problems, including:
Drafts: Poor seals can enable drafts, decreasing energy performance.Sticking Sashes: Paint or swelling wood might trigger sashes to stick or jam.Broken Glass: Weather or effects can lead to glass damage.Decayed Frames: Extended exposure to moisture can rot the wooden frames.Decreased Aesthetics: Fading or peeling paint can interfere with the window's beauty.Maintenance Tips for Sash Windows

How frequently should sash windows be fixed or preserved?
It is a good idea to check sash windows at least when a year. However, maintenance should be conducted more frequently in areas with extreme weather or contamination.
2. Can I repair sash windows myself?
While small repairs can frequently be managed by homeowners, significant issues, specifically those involving wood rot or structural damage, need to be left to specialists to make sure correct maintenance.
3. Exist any grants or moneying for sash window repairs in the UK?
Certain local councils and preservation charities might provide financing or support for repairs, particularly in noted buildings. It's helpful to contact your local authority.
4. For how long does a sash window repair generally take?
Repair times can differ. Easy tasks like re-glazing or restringing can take a couple of hours, while comprehensive repairs might take several days, especially if numerous windows are included.
